Belmar has closed its boardwalk to the public. Officials in that beach town say the move is to protect individuals from the spread of Covid-19. Some other communities are expected to consider closing their beaches and/or boardwalks.

Cape May County has five more cases of coronavirus. County officials confirmed Sunday evening that five new cases have been added to our count. Lower Township has four cases, Middle Township has three, and there are two apiece in Cape May City and Avalon.

161 people have died as a result of coronavirus in New Jersey. State health officials announced Sunday that more than 2,000 additional positive test results have been received, and the State has now had 13,386 infected with COVID-19. Bergen County has over 2,000 cases.

Around 700 police officers have tested positive for coronavirus in the State of New Jersey, according to State Police Col. Patrick Callahan. Callahan says there are also about 700 officers currently quarantined at home. Callahan says cops have tested positive in all 21 New Jersey counties.

Governor Phil Murphy announced that banks are giving homeowners 90-day forgiveness on mortgages due to the coronavirus. Murphy announced Saturday that banks and mortgage companies have also agreed to stop any foreclosures or evictions for the next 60 days.

President Donald Trump is considering a two-week quarantine for parts of New York, New Jersey and Connecticut. The quarantine would mean that no one in those areas would be able to travel out of state. Trump also praised the performance of Governor Phil Murphy.
